U.S. Under Secretary of State concludes Pakistan visit

Islamabad, July 21 PPI: Visiting United States Under Secretary of State for Economic, Energy & Agricultural Affairs, Reuben Jeffery discussed with Pakistani officials importance of sound economic policies that address challenges of rising food, fuel prices and support a stable, democratic and prosperous Pakistan.

He was speaking on conclusion of his three-day visit here Saturday which was to discuss economic issues in context of Pak-US relations ahead of Prime MinisterYousuf Raza Gilani's upcoming visit to U.S.

Jeffery met with Gilani, senior officials, private sector leaders and discussed how to promote poverty reduction, private sector development, vocational training, agriculture, education, access to credit and how to promote new investment inPakistan particularly in energy and infrastructure sectors.

He stressed great value that U.S. places on its long-term and wide ranging strategic partnership with Pakistan. He updated officials and private sector on Reconstruction Opportunity Zone legislation that is now before U.S. Congress. The legislation aims to promote economic growth in Pakistan's Federally Administered Tribal Areas FATA and North West Frontier Province by allowing companies that set up manufacturingoperations to export their products duty-free into the U.S.
